Oconee County Baseball Star Hopes to Make Big Leagues

Oconee County’s pitcher/outfielder star player Brooks Crawford is hoping to enter the MLB draft. 

Crawford attended a camp when he was 12 years old with current Clemson head coach Jack Leggett. He verbally committed with coach Leggett to attend Clemson. Crawford has been scouted by major league scouts and wants to play in the major leagues.
